Middlefield Banc Corp. operates as the bank holding company for The Middlefield Banking Company that provides various commercial banking services to small and medium-sized businesses, professionals, small business owners, and retail customers in northeastern and central Ohio. It provides checking, savings, negotiable order of withdrawal accounts, money market accounts, time certificates of deposit, commercial loans, real estate loans, various consumer loans, safe deposit facilities, and travelers' checks. The company also offers operational and working capital, term business, residential construction, professional, and residential and mortgage loans, as well as consumer installment loans for home improvements, automobiles, boats, and other personal expenditures; loans to finance capital purchases; selected guaranteed or subsidized loan programs for small businesses; and agricultural loans. Further, it provides official checks, money orders, ATM services, as well as IRA accounts; online banking and bill payment services to individuals; and online cash management services to business customers. In addition, the company resolves and disposes troubled assets in Ohio. As of December 31, 2021, it has 17 banking centers in Chardon, Newbury, and Middlefield, Garrettsville, Mantua, Orwell, Cortland, Dublin, Westerville, Sunbury, Powell, Beachwood, Solon, Twinsburg, and Plain City; as well as an administrative office in Middlefield, and a loan production office in Mentor. Middlefield Banc Corp. was founded in 1901 and is headquartered in Middlefield, Ohio.

Understanding SEC Filings

Essential regulatory documents for investors

SEC filings are mandatory documents that publicly traded companies must submit to the Securities and Exchange Commission. These reports provide critical insights into a company's financial health, operations, risks, and strategic direction. For investors conducting due diligence, these filings are the most authoritative source of company information.

10-K

Annual Report

Comprehensive annual financial report filed within 60-90 days of fiscal year-end. Includes audited financial statements, management discussion & analysis (MD&A), risk factors, and detailed business operations. The most thorough financial disclosure of the year.

Filed annually
10-Q

Quarterly Report

Unaudited quarterly financial report filed within 40-45 days after each of the first three fiscal quarters. Provides updates on financial position, results of operations, and significant events. Essential for tracking quarterly performance trends.

Filed 3 times per year
8-K

Current Report

Event-driven filing for material events that shareholders should know about, filed within 4 business days. Includes acquisitions, executive changes, bankruptcy, earnings releases, and other significant developments. Critical for staying informed about breaking news.

Filed as events occur
DEF 14A

Proxy Statement

Definitive proxy statement sent to shareholders before annual meetings. Contains executive compensation details, board member information, voting matters, and corporate governance policies. Key for understanding management incentives and board composition.

Filed before shareholder meetings
S-1

Registration Statement

Initial registration for securities offerings, including IPOs. Provides detailed company history, business model, financial statements, risk factors, and use of proceeds. Essential for evaluating new investment opportunities and understanding company fundamentals.

Filed for new offerings
20-F

Foreign Annual Report

Annual report for foreign private issuers, equivalent to Form 10-K for non-U.S. companies. Filed within 4-6 months of fiscal year-end. Contains audited financials, business description, and regulatory disclosures adapted for international companies.

Foreign companies only

Why SEC Filings Matter

  • Regulatory Accuracy: Filings are subject to SEC review and legal penalties for misstatements, ensuring high data quality
  • Management Insights: MD&A sections reveal management's perspective on trends, challenges, and future outlook
  • Risk Assessment: Detailed risk factor disclosures help investors understand potential threats to business operations
  • Competitive Analysis: Business descriptions and segment data enable comparison with industry peers
  • Historical Context: Years of filings provide trend analysis and context for current performance
